Kit Building / ITLA Modular Industry
April 07, 2024, 08:28:17 PM
This structure is made form ITLA industrial Wall Modules.  This will go where the cardboard mock up was on the layout if you've followed my Layout Build.  There are several different wall modules.  Different widths, brick vs concrete, window types and one with fire escapes and another with a large loading door for train entry.
